Responsibilities

  • Serve as the Finance Manager on larger or more complex projects or clients including contract and pricing negotiations (with oversight)
  • Supervise team of 1-2 finance professionals
  • Review and approve client budgets
  • Partner with account teams in pricing client proposals, responding to Requests for Proposals/Information, and developing budgets (with oversight)
  • Facilitate negotiation of client and vendor contracts between clients/vendors, account staff/senior management, and legal department, including full review of all business terms (with oversight)
  • Ensure that projects are managed in accordance with contracts; create summary sheets (contract cheat sheets) for PR teams
  • Ensure written client agreement is obtained (via contract, letter of agreement, signed scope of work, etc.) for all work and is appropriately archived and classified
  • Assist PR teams with monthly project budget to actual tracking and other required client reporting
  • Coordinate data collection for client audits
  • Communicate with clients regarding budgets, billing, and accounts receivable issues
  • Maintain a catalog of required client reporting and ensure timely completion
  • Review monthly fee and expense detail
  • Provide commentary on variances of actual revenue to budget and forecast
  • Develop annual operating budgets and maintain accurate monthly/quarterly forecasts
  • Prepare management reports, identify and communicate areas of concern, and suggest improvements to account staff and management (e.g., client profitability, utilization, over/under service, missing time, revenue risk, and staffing plans)
  • Review monthly fees for accuracy and compliance with Edelman Revenue Recognition policy
  • Facilitate monthly billing – liaison between account staff and billing department and review billing reports
  • Review time and expense write-offs and unbilled WIP
  • Accountable for timely and valuable AR collection status commentary and liaison with Accounts Receivable
  • Supervise project setup process for the department and perform Business Manager role for larger or more complex projects
  • Contribute to performance appraisal process for peers and managers
  • Supervise and train Finance personnel and be accountable for their work
  • Train PR staff on internal finance systems, procedures, and financial project management
  • Set achievable goals and tasks, delegate opportunities, and provide resources for staff to meet their goals; consistently measure and reward goal achievement
  • Ad hoc requests and projects
